Abstract

Five macrolide antibiotics (erythromycin A, 1; oleandomycin, 3a; tylosin, 4a; spira-mycins, 5a; leucomycin A3, 6a) have been phosphorylated enzymatically using cell-free ex-tracts derived from Streptomyces coelicolor UC 5240. The necessary cofactors and the rates of the conversion have been determined. © 1987, JAPAN ANTIBIOTICS RESEARCH ASSOCIATION. All rights reserved.
